Loose or broken hinges

The majority of window problems in upvc result from broken or loose hinges. The hinges can be replaced to fix the problem. You will then be in a position to open and close your window normally again. This is a cost-effective, quick, and easy repair that will save you money on replacing windows.

Our upvc windows come with friction hinges. They are usually used on side-hung windows but can also be used on top-hung windows. These are available in either a 17mm or 13mm stack. If there are gaps in the sash, or when the sash is hard to open, they are generally replaced.

It is crucial to read the instructions and follow the opening directions when installing a new upvc hinge. A arrow is on the hinge. To function correctly, the arrow should be directed towards the opening. If you aren't sure what kind of hinge to order contact us and we'll be happy to advise.

Regularly lubricating your window hinges is essential. It will allow the sash open and close without difficulty and prevent cracking or warping of the upvc window. You can apply an oil that is light in nature and contains corrosion inhibitors to grease the hinges of your window made of upvc. This should be done at minimum every two years.

This is a great method to keep your window in good condition and keep it in good working order. Also, make sure that the hinges do not appear to be loosened or broken. This can be fixed by making a few small adjustments to your screws. You should have no further problems with your windows made of upvc.

It's a straightforward fix however you may have to spend some time finding the right screw size. It is important to keep in mind that screws can become loose in time if they are not frequently used. They should be tightened and checked each year.
